A packaged rooftop unit rests on an insulated roof curb extending a minimum of 16 inches above the roof surface and bearing on a roof deck supported by typical roof joists. Heating water supply and return piping route through the curb directly into the unit to connect to the heating coil, alongside a full-size condensate drain positioned tight to the side of the unit. The unit features a factory-provided economizer air intake hood and relief air option, with a bottom return air opening connected to a full-size return air duct. The connection between the unit and supply duct is sized based on the actual rooftop unit opening size and configuration.
